President Bola Tinubu has arrived in Lagos ahead of the Muslim festival of Eid-El-Fitr, marking the end of the month of Ramadan.
The President was received at the Presidential Wing of Murtala Muhammed International Airport (MMIA) by the Lagos State governor, Babajide Sanwo-Olu, in the company of top officials of the federal and state governments.
The festival is expected to take place on Tuesday or Wednesday, depending on the lunar calendar, heralding the new Islamic month of Shawwal.
Ahead of the president’s arrival, his spokesman, Ajuri Ngelale noted that he would continue official duties during and after the Eid-el-Fitr holidays.
